Moon Opera River has upcoming performance in Statesboro

Georgia Southern University alumni are performing in the Moon River Opera in Statesboro on April 7th, 2025 at 7pm at Statesboro First United Methodist Church. 

Moon River Opera is an opera company based in Savannah, Georgia. It has been operating for seven years under Brenna Dudley's artistic direction. Along with the other performers, Dudley graduated from Georgia Southern. She graduated with a degree in vocal performance. 

Moon River's motto is "making opera fun again." To incorporate fun into opera, they have different-themed recitals.

The performers improve their opera, do site-specific opera, and even do drunk opera. At the drunk opera performances, with safety regulations, both the audience members and the performers can sing while enjoying a drink. At site-specific performances, the performers sing in different places around Savannah, including a spooky, historic mansion. 

"Opera has this long history of being accessible and fun -- not the way modern audiences tend to think about opera,” said Dudley. 

Dudley believes there is a stereotype around opera performances. Instead of having audience members think that they need to dress in their finest clothes and sit stiff as a board, the performances can be more appealing.

Georgia Southern and Statesboro is where most of the people involved in Moon River Opera met on-stage and off-stage. It is the place where they developed a musical community. 

"In a very real way, there would be no Moon River Opera without our time there," Dudley said. "We treat our performers very, very, well, but something equally as important is we want to interact with the community."

In Statesboro, on Monday, April 7th, the performance will be at Statesboro First United Methodist Church on South Main Street. The show is free of charge, with donations happily accepted.

"Free for everyone," Dudley said. "Come and come as you are."
